At Myrtle Beach on vacay, my wife and I were in the mood for Mexican (more Tex Mex) fare and Nacho Hippo looked interesting. As our custom, we went for early dinner. The place was packed! But we only had to wait about 15 minutes. Monica brought us menus, which we had already been looking over. My wife got the Sloppy Burrito with chicken. I decided to try their special Hipponachomus Nachos, personal size. We started off with Tortilla chips and Queso dip. I also asked for hot salsa, extra cost. Turned out to be Mango Habanero and a bit sweet. Didn't think I would like it but I did! Our food came and servings were huge. My wife loved her (usual) burrito. Our chips and dips were also great. My Nachos? Shazam! A huge pile of chips with Chili, Chicken, Taco Meat, two cheeses, lettuce and Pico de Gallo. It was really great. And so much I had to take a third back to resort. Many more cars arriving as we were leaving and headed to inside and outside seating. Food was great, service excellent, ambiance a bit noisy. Is the patio dog friendly?

As much as we love animals, our restaurant is not equipped with the necessary features for DHEC to rate us as "pet friendly". However, we would never deny someone their service animal.
